Integrated Use Case for Bittensor and Handshake Domains: Decentralized AI Service Marketplace with Secure Domain Management
Bittensor Overview: Bittensor is a decentralized network that allows machine learning models to interact and transact. It uses blockchain technology to ensure secure and transparent transactions between AI models. The primary use case of Bittensor is to create a decentralized marketplace for AI services.
